500 inch Caddy into 89 'Bird

So I've got a pair of 500 cid Caddy motors. One is a 70 high compression, the other is a 74. I plan on using the 70 heads with the 74 short block in order to see about 9:1 compression. An aluminum performer intake and Comp 268H should round out the combo. Anyway, does anyone have info on doing the swap? I can't find anything anywhere on this. My immediate concerns are the motor mounts, front clearance, and transmission cross member location with a TH400. Any help would be appreciated.
